- All install hooks now respect their respective XYZ_BINARY env vars (e.g., WGET_BINARY, CHROME_BINARY, YTDLP_BINARY, etc.) - Support both absolute paths (/usr/bin/wget2) and binary names (wget2) - Dynamic bin_name used in Dependency JSONL output - Updated 11 install hooks to follow the new pattern - Mark checklist items as complete in TODO_hook_architecture.md
